Business Overview

Franklin India Money Market Fund (Q-IDCW) is an ideal investment option for conservative investors seeking stability and liquidity. This fund primarily invests in short-term debt instruments, making it a safer alternative for parking funds while earning potential returns. It is suitable for individuals looking to preserve capital while having easy access to their money. With a focus on quality investments, this fund aims to provide consistent income with lower risk, making it a smart choice for both new and experienced investors.

Opportunity vs Risk

Opportunities
  • Stable returns in low-interest environment
  • Diversification for conservative investors
  • Potential for capital preservation
  • Liquidity during market volatility
  • Tax efficiency compared to fixed deposits
Risks ⚠️
  • Interest rate fluctuations impact returns
  • Credit risk from underlying securities
  • Market volatility affects liquidity
  • Limited growth compared to equities
  • Regulatory changes may impact fund
